Fri, 22 Jul 2011 00:12:03 -0700Removed comment questioning the code's correctness (the answer: it's correct).
Ryan C. Gordon <icculus@icculus.org> [Fri, 22 Jul 2011 00:12:03 -0700] rev 5579
Removed comment questioning the code's correctness (the answer: it's correct).

Fri, 22 Jul 2011 00:09:58 -0700Don't use a bitfield for this.
Ryan C. Gordon <icculus@icculus.org> [Fri, 22 Jul 2011 00:09:58 -0700] rev 5578
Don't use a bitfield for this.

It pads out to an int anyhow, but causes code bloat as the compiler tries to
mask and shift for that specific bit.

Wed, 20 Jul 2011 16:35:37 -0700Work on systems without sa_sigaction.
Ryan C. Gordon <icculus@icculus.org> [Wed, 20 Jul 2011 16:35:37 -0700] rev 5577
Work on systems without sa_sigaction.

Wed, 20 Jul 2011 16:35:04 -0700Need to add this line for sa_sigaction check in configure to work. SDL-1.2
Ryan C. Gordon <icculus@icculus.org> [Wed, 20 Jul 2011 16:35:04 -0700] rev 5576
Need to add this line for sa_sigaction check in configure to work.

Tue, 19 Jul 2011 22:10:35 -0700Fixed minor typo in a comment. SDL-1.2
Ryan C. Gordon <icculus@icculus.org> [Tue, 19 Jul 2011 22:10:35 -0700] rev 5575
Fixed minor typo in a comment.

Mon, 18 Jul 2011 20:32:40 -0700Quartz: Don't use -[NSWindow center] on the fullscreen window. SDL-1.2
Ryan C. Gordon <icculus@icculus.org> [Mon, 18 Jul 2011 20:32:40 -0700] rev 5574
Quartz: Don't use -[NSWindow center] on the fullscreen window.

"Centering" is a little off-center, vertically. Apparently in non-fullscreen
apps, this is more aestetically pleasing or something.

Fixes positioning on fullscreen video modes on Mac OS X.

Mon, 18 Jul 2011 14:55:24 -0700Patched to compile on older GLX headers.
Ryan C. Gordon <icculus@icculus.org> [Mon, 18 Jul 2011 14:55:24 -0700] rev 5573
Patched to compile on older GLX headers.

Mon, 18 Jul 2011 14:34:19 -0700Added support for GLX_EXT_swap_control, and cleaned up some other extensions.
Ryan C. Gordon <icculus@icculus.org> [Mon, 18 Jul 2011 14:34:19 -0700] rev 5572
Added support for GLX_EXT_swap_control, and cleaned up some other extensions.

This allows the Nvidia Linux drivers to use SDL_GL_SetSwapInterval(0).

Mon, 18 Jul 2011 14:31:37 -0700The SwapInterval APIs should fail without a current OpenGL context.
Ryan C. Gordon <icculus@icculus.org> [Mon, 18 Jul 2011 14:31:37 -0700] rev 5571
The SwapInterval APIs should fail without a current OpenGL context.

Mon, 18 Jul 2011 14:30:46 -0700Record the new OpenGL context as current during SDL_GL_CreateContext().
Ryan C. Gordon <icculus@icculus.org> [Mon, 18 Jul 2011 14:30:46 -0700] rev 5570
Record the new OpenGL context as current during SDL_GL_CreateContext().